Abstract

Depiction of graphics which are displayed in combination with function graphs is accelerated. Graphics to be displayed on a display device in combination with function graphs are selected and drawn according to the graphic information stored in the graphic information storage area of the data storage RAM memory. The selection is executed based on whether the rectangular region of interest is even partially within the region to be displayed on the screen. The selected graphics are written to the display RAM as bit images by a CPU which operates under the direction of programs set in the program ROM, and displayed on a display device. The data in the graphic information storage area is displayed on a display device upon pressing an EDIT MODE key, edited by operation with an EDIT key, DELETE key, character keys, etc., and the display device is switched to the graphic screen with the modified graphic thereon, upon repressing the EDIT MODE key.
